Output 77f23d94e90495d86ff74333496cfb2ccace4fd8a0dad57591d5737519fb8240:0

value
1294910543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b90b89214221a794028c1ea51a43a38dd94ac426 OP_EQUAL
address
2NA7epHTUHYhmbeYWrTDwiM5zKR3PBSjsEZ
transaction
77f23d94e90495d86ff74333496cfb2ccace4fd8a0dad57591d5737519fb8240